Output ebc69e9b3a035a41c3f88da84760765faaad512be68530d25abe126a60edf33e:0

value
103352125
script pubkey
OP_0 OP_PUSHBYTES_20 e7a98906d67bf3dccbd94f719cdf633b8ff6ef17
address
bc1qu75cjpkk00eaej7efaceehmr8w8ldmchzfdeey
transaction
ebc69e9b3a035a41c3f88da84760765faaad512be68530d25abe126a60edf33e
confirmations
104776
spent
true